常见物理量的估测值一、长度的估测值中学生身高约1.6—1.8m,手掌宽度约10cm, 指甲宽度约1cm。中学生步长约50—70cm。居民楼房每层楼高约3m。教室门高约2m。考试所用答题卡宽度约30cm。一只新铅笔长度18cm。物理课本长约26cm,宽18cm。1元硬币直径约2.4cm,10元人民币长约14cm。普通日光灯长约1m。课桌高度约0.8m,椅子高度约0.4m。 物理课本一张纸的厚度约
先注意 这不是双目摄像头的 测距哦~~计算物体之间的距离与计算图像中物体的大小算法思路非常相似——都是从参考对象开始的。我们将使用0.25美分作为我们的参考对象,它的宽度为0.955英寸。并且我们还将0.25美分总是放在图片最左侧使其容易识别。这样它就满足了我们上面提到的参考对象的两个特征。我们的目标是找到0.25美分,然后利用0.25美分的尺寸来测量0.25美分硬币与所有其他物体之间的距离。定义
转载 2023-12-19 19:48:55
593阅读
# 使用 Python OpenCV 进行身高测量 在现实生活中,身高是一个非常重要的生理特征。在一些特定的领域,例如医疗、运动和健身等,身高测量可能需要更加精准和自动化的方法。借助 PythonOpenCV,结合计算机视觉技术,我们可以实现自动化的身高测量。 ## 原理 基本上,我们可以通过摄像头获取到一个人的图像,然后通过图像处理技术测量该图像中人的高度。实现这一点的方法主要有以下
原创 2024-08-04 05:31:05
422阅读
利用openCV或其他工具编写程序实现对图片中框选出的图片测量其宽度。实现过程1、编写程序       目标图片如下    根据展示的程序功能编写对应的程序:第一步,读取显示图像的功能openCV已经提供了函数imread()和imshow(),代码如下import cv2import numpy
opencv 中轮廓特征包括:如面积,周长,质心,边界框等*弧长与面积测量*多边形拟合*获取轮廓的多边形拟合结果python-opencv API提供方法:cv2.moments()用来计算图像中的中心矩(最高到三阶),cv2.HuMoments()用于由中心矩计算Hu矩,同时配合函数cv2.contourArea()函数计算轮廓面积和cv2.arcLength()来计算轮廓或曲线长度*cv.ap
转载 2024-04-23 21:54:13
146阅读
# 如何实现Android测量空间高度 ## 流程图 ```mermaid flowchart TD A(开始) B[获取View对象] C[测量View的高度] D(结束) A --> B B --> C C --> D ``` ## 步骤 | 步骤 | 操作 | | ---- | ---- | | 1 | 获取需要测量高度的Vi
原创 2024-03-13 05:03:28
61阅读
# Android RecyclerView 测量高度的实现 在Android开发中,RecyclerView是一个非常常用的控件,用于处理大量数据的展示。在某些情况下,我们需要测量RecyclerView的高度,以便在UI设计中实现更好的布局效果。本文将为您详细介绍如何在Android中实现RecyclerView高度测量,并这个过程的每一个步骤都会清晰地展示出来。 ## 整体流程 下面
原创 10月前
143阅读
OpenCV单目视觉定位(测量)系统The System of Vision Location with Signal CameraAbstract:This passage mainly describes how to locate with signalcamera,which bases on OpenCV library.Key words: OpenCV; Locate;Sig
转载 2024-07-25 17:35:27
59阅读
由于需要实现一个物体的测量,但是已有QT程序,最后的整体功能需要在C#集成实现。首先有两个方案:(1)利用已有的QT程序以及界面,直接在C#中调用QT,或者C++程序,但是经过尝试,发现两者之间进行调用不是那么的简单,涉及到许多变量定义的不用以及数据结构的不同。因此决定方案(2),在C#里重新实现该功能。由于也是第一次接触相机的使用,因此就借此记录一下。一、首先是相机的标定,这个很简单,也有大量的
# Python OpenCV 深度距离测量入门 在计算机视觉和图像处理的领域,深度距离测量是一项重要的技术。本文将指导你如何使用 PythonOpenCV 进行深度距离测量。本文将详细介绍整个流程、所需的库、代码实现及相关注释,确保你能顺利完成这一项目。 ## 整体流程 下面是深度距离测量的基本步骤: | 步骤 | 描述
原创 11月前
98阅读
鼠标点击后返回三维坐标,看项目需求自行改进优化。我这里想往后再改为自动返回前景坐标的。   这个程序是使用opencv3.0版本来测试的,2.4版本有些编译错误,懒得改了,直接使用3.0的吧。  VS2013+opencv3.0+Release模式测试成功。鼠标点击左键在视差图上即可以进行测距,返回三维坐标。  主要用到matlab双目标定的参数。&nbsp
转载 2024-02-26 15:05:01
222阅读
前言     ?大四是整个大学期间最忙碌的时光,一边要忙着备考或实习为毕业后面临的就业升学做准备,一边要为毕业设计耗费大量精力。近几年各个学校要求的毕设项目越来越难,有不少课题是研究生级别难度的,对本科同学来说是充满挑战。为帮助大家顺利通过和节省时间与精力投入到更重要的就业和考试中去,学长分享优质的选题经验和毕设项目与技术思路。?对毕设有任何疑问都可以问学长哦!选题指导:大家好
前言     ?大四是整个大学期间最忙碌的时光,一边要忙着备考或实习为毕业后面临的就业升学做准备,一边要为毕业设计耗费大量精力。近几年各个学校要求的毕设项目越来越难,有不少课题是研究生级别难度的,对本科同学来说是充满挑战。为帮助大家顺利通过和节省时间与精力投入到更重要的就业和考试中去,学长分享优质的选题经验和毕设项目与技术思路。?对毕设有任何疑问都可以问学长哦!本次分享的课题是
原标题:三种测量仪器使用详解,测绘人必须要知道水准仪及其使用方法高程测量是测绘地形图的基本工作之一,另外大量的工程、建筑施工也必须量测地面高程,利用水准仪进行水准测量是精密测量高程的主要方法,具体如下:一、水准仪器组合1.望远镜 2.调整手轮 3.圆水准器 4.微调手轮 5.水平制动手轮 6.管水准器 7.水平微调手轮 8.脚架二、操作要点在未知两点间,摆开三脚架,从仪器箱取出水准仪安放在三脚架上
一些概念首先我们要搞清楚这几个概念,根据 View 里面的概念(因为 ImageView 就是继承 View的),一个 View 来说,它有一个 Location(位置),这个是相对于父元素的位置,由一对坐标设置,top 和 left,然后他还有一个 dimensions(大小),width 和 height 控制。所以你在 xml 文件中设置 layouot_width 和 layout_hei
转载 2024-04-15 12:01:45
117阅读
Android系统控件无法满足我们的需求,因此有必要自定义View。MeasureSpec的简介MesureSpec可以理解为测量View大小的依据。它由一个32位的int值组成,前两位表示测量模式,后30位表示大小值。 测量模式(Mode)的类型有3种:UNSPECIFIED、EXACTLY 和 AT_MOST。 Measure源码分析public class MeasureSpec {
转载 2024-08-21 16:43:32
32阅读
先放结论:可以学到角度测量的公式。可以学到如果按下鼠标时,就获取坐标点。目录相关库:导入图片:定义鼠标事件回调函数:计算角度:结果分析,发现原因:完整代码:接下来,就愉快地开始讲解这个项目的代码。 相关库:opencv库需要下载安装,math不用下载安装。import cv2 import math导入图片:非常入门的导入图片。path = 'test.png' img = cv2.im
转载 2024-01-25 20:26:28
76阅读
## Android LinearLayout 重新测量高度 在Android开发中,LinearLayout是一种常用的布局容器,用于在水平或垂直方向上排列子视图。当我们在LinearLayout中添加子视图时,它会根据子视图的大小自动调整自身的尺寸。然而,有时候我们可能需要手动重新测量LinearLayout的高度,以确保它适应子视图的变化。本文将介绍如何在Android中重新测量Linea
原创 2023-08-30 09:02:33
557阅读
# Android 中测量 View 高度的方式 在 Android 开发中,View 的高度和宽度的测量是非常重要的,尤其是在用户界面(UI)设计中。测量 View 的高度不仅关乎视觉效果,还影响应用的性能。因此,了解如何正确测量 View 的高度,将有助于我们编写出更流畅且美观的应用程序。 ## 1. View 的测量机制 在 Android 里,View 的大小是在 `onMeasur
原创 8月前
49阅读
1、自定义View我们大部分时候只需重写两个函数:onMeasure()、onDraw()。onMeasure负责对当前View的尺寸进行测量,onDraw负责把当前这个View绘制出来。2、要写2个构造函数:public MyView(Context context) { super(context); } public MyView(Context con
  • 1
  • 2
  • 3
  • 4
  • 5